Output 6124e7dcbb1d7f6b3f8b6c29324edc26d61fb569263dc254dafeaba3a47ae94c:0

value
8659627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ade93650b7ad57fd5597b88a78f0523478c6e2b8 OP_EQUAL
address
3HYaCbXCmucA2PgtMXAoQByRY3QoVfdBv7
transaction
6124e7dcbb1d7f6b3f8b6c29324edc26d61fb569263dc254dafeaba3a47ae94c
spent
true